Aluminum 7075

Material Data Sheet

With zinc as it’s primary alloying element, it is exceptionally strong. A member of the 7000 series, it is one of the strongest alloys available and is comparable to many types of steel. Although it has high strength, it has lower corrosion resistance than other common aluminum alloys and does not offer the same levels of machinability or weldability.

Due to its high strength, it is often used in applications where it will come under high stress such as aircraft wing spar and ground support equipment.
